Bacon is a savory, salty, and smoky cured meat typically made from pork belly or back cuts. Known for its crispy texture when cooked, bacon has a rich, umami flavor that enhances a wide variety of dishes. Its appearance ranges from thin, marbled strips to thicker cuts, often with a balance of fat and lean meat. Bacon is a versatile ingredient that adds depth and indulgence to breakfast, appetizers, and even desserts, making it a favorite among food enthusiasts searching for bold flavors and satisfying textures.

Store unopened bacon in the refrigerator at 40°F (4°C) or below and use it by the 'use by' date on the package. Once opened, wrap t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il and refrigerate, using within 7 days. For longer storage, freeze bacon in an airtight container or freezer-safe bag for up to 6 months. Thaw frozen bacon in the refrigerator before use to maintain quality and safety.
